What is Google Analytics 4?

Google Analytics 4 (GA4) is Google's next-generation analytics platform, replacing Universal Analytics. GA4 uses an event-based data model and provides campaign attribution reporting through the Traffic Acquisition and Campaign reports. Accurate GA4 attribution depends entirely on consistent UTM parameters — making UTM governance and GA4 reporting two sides of the same coin.

What does UTM Mind do with Google Analytics 4?

UTM Mind connects to your GA4 property via OAuth and pulls campaign attribution data directly into your dashboard. You can view which UTM sources, mediums, and campaigns are driving traffic and conversions — without switching to the GA4 interface. This closes the loop between UTM creation and attribution measurement, giving your team a single workspace for both.

Integration Capabilities

Sync Level

The GA4 integration is read-only. UTM Mind reads campaign attribution data from your GA4 property to surface it in the UTM Mind dashboard. It does not write any data to GA4.

Macro Support

The GA4 integration is for attribution reporting only. Macro support is not applicable — UTM parameters are read from GA4 as they were set when links were created.

Live Preview

Preview is not applicable for the GA4 integration, which is read-only.

Frequently Asked Questions

What GA4 data can UTM Mind access?

UTM Mind reads campaign attribution data from your GA4 property: sessions, users, conversions, and revenue broken down by utm_source, utm_medium, utm_campaign, utm_content, and utm_term. It does not access user-level data, raw event streams, or any personally identifiable information.

Does UTM Mind write any data to GA4?

No. The GA4 integration is entirely read-only. UTM Mind reads attribution data from GA4 to display it in your dashboard. It does not create events, modify properties, or write any data to your GA4 account.

Can I connect multiple GA4 properties?

Yes. UTM Mind supports multiple GA4 properties. After connecting your Google account, you can select which GA4 property to view and switch between properties in the dashboard.

Why is GA4 attribution important for UTM management?

GA4 attribution is entirely dependent on UTM parameters. If your UTM parameters are inconsistent — misspelled sources, inconsistent mediums, missing campaigns — your GA4 reports will be fragmented and unreliable. UTM Mind helps you maintain UTM consistency so your GA4 attribution data is accurate and actionable.

How do I connect GA4 to UTM Mind?

Go to the Integrations page in your UTM Mind dashboard, click "Connect" next to Google Analytics 4, and sign in with the Google account that has access to your GA4 property. Select the GA4 property you want to connect and click Authorize.
